Bumps pylint from 2.3.1 to 2.4.4.

Changelog *Sourced from [pylint's changelog](https://github.com/PyCQA/pylint/blob/master/ChangeLog).* > What's New in Pylint 2.4.4? > =========================== > Release date: 2019-11-13 > > * Exempt all the names found in type annotations from ``unused-import`` > > The previous code was assuming that only ``typing`` names need to be > exempted, but we need to do that for the rest of the type comment > names as well. > > Close [#3112](https://github-redirect.dependabot.com/PyCQA/pylint/issues/3112) > > * Relax type import detection for names that do not come from the ``typing`` module > > Close [#3191](https://github-redirect.dependabot.com/PyCQA/pylint/issues/3191) > > > What's New in Pylint 2.4.3? > =========================== > > Release date: 2019-10-18 > > * Fix an issue with ``unnecessary-comprehension`` in comprehensions with additional repacking of elements. > > Close [#3148](https://github-redirect.dependabot.com/PyCQA/pylint/issues/3148) > > * ``import-outside-toplevel`` is emitted for ``ImportFrom`` nodes as well. > > Close [#3175](https://github-redirect.dependabot.com/PyCQA/pylint/issues/3175) > > * Do not emit ``no-method-argument`` for functions using positional only args. > > Close [#3161](https://github-redirect.dependabot.com/PyCQA/pylint/issues/3161) > > * ``consider-using-sys-exit`` is no longer emitted when `exit` is imported in the local scope. > > Close [#3147](https://github-redirect.dependabot.com/PyCQA/pylint/issues/3147) > > * `invalid-overridden-method` takes `abc.abstractproperty` in account > > Close [#3150](https://github-redirect.dependabot.com/PyCQA/pylint/issues/3150) > > * Fixed ``missing-yield-type-doc`` getting incorrectly raised when > a generator does not document a yield type but has a type annotation. > > Closes [#3185](https://github-redirect.dependabot.com/PyCQA/pylint/issues/3185) > > * ``typing.overload`` functions are exempted from ``too-many-function-args`` > > Close [#3170](https://github-redirect.dependabot.com/PyCQA/pylint/issues/3170) > ...
